The Huntsville St. Patrick's Day Parade will be at 11:00 AM on Saturday, March 15th, in downtown Huntsville, AL. However, you need to be in line and ready to go by 10:45 AM in Lot K across from the Post Office at 620 Clinton Avenue. Staging begins in Lot K at 8:30 AM. Unlike previous years, there is no designated spot to line up by a cone. We just show up and claim a spot in line for our designated province. We've usually end up in the Connacht Province, which is the second line to start the parade, so we should finish relatively early. The Connacht Province line is the second one from the right as you enter Lot K. We'll probably get as close as we can to the Innerspace Brewing company's "shuttle" float at the start of the line.
Since we don't have any vehicles, CO Richard L. Trulson will have our place picked out by 10:15 AM. You don't have to be there quite that early, but make sure you are lined up in Lot K and ready to go by 10:45AM. Enter Lot K on foot via Clinton Avenue. If you need help, ask the parade organizers at the green help tent for the "USS Wernher von Braun" group. Otherwise, just look for the geeks in Starfleet uniforms.
Due to the expense and hassle, we will NOT be handing out candy or anything during the parade. If you'd like to carry our signs and banners, we would appreciate the help and publicity.
For those marching, paid parking is available in VBC lot L and City Garage M. However, it may be easier to Uber/Lyft or carpool in. There may be free spots closer to Lot K, but they will fill up quickly. Do NOT park in Lot K itself, or in the business lots beside it on Woodson St. Some park along the Heart of Huntsville Drive, though Street and other lot parking is at your own risk.
Last year, the CO parked at the end of the parade route in the huge lot next to the Lumberyard. He then walked down to the Bus Transfer Station at the 500 Church St and Cleveland Ave. He then took Patton Route 2 bus line, which has a stop at Lot K about 5 minutes after departing the Transfer Station every 30 minutes. Cost was only $1.

They will have portable restrooms at lot K available for marcher use. Bottled water is no longer available to purchase, so make sure you bring your own. Even though St. Patrick's Day is known for its green beer and other drunken revelry, the parade is a family friendly event. Therefore, alcoholic beverages are NOT allowed in the parade or staging areas.
Keep in mind that March weather can be anything from sun to snow, so plan accordingly. Even if it rains, the parade will go on. It will be cancelled only in the event of lightening or other severe weather. Keep an eye on their Facebook page and this event page for any cancellation notices. Even if the parade goes on, we may not march if the weather is extremely cold. Umbrellas or hats will be good to keep rain or sun off your head and face. Since you can still sunburn in cloudy conditions, use sunscreen.
Even though we're a Star Trek club, any and all science-fiction / fantasy / comic / genre fans are welcome to march with us. Feel free to invite your family and friends to the event so they can march with us. You do not have to be Irish to March.
Keep in mind that the parade route is 1.6 miles long, which will probably take about an hour to march due to all the starts and stops. Depending on where we are in the line-up, we should be finished marching by 12 noon. Therefore, you will probably be on your feet for about two hours by the time you add in the wait time at the beginning. Please be mindful of these conditions if you have any sort of physical issues that might prevent you from marching.
Also note that the parade route is no longer a circular route that brings us back to the beginning at Lot K. The parade now ends at AM Booth's Lumberyard at the corner of Meridian Street and Cleveland Avenue. Transportation back to Lot K will be provided via the Huntsville city shuttle busses. The City's small Orbit busses are scheduled to depart the Lumberyard every 15 minutes throughout the parade, though they weren't very diligent about being exactly where they said they would be last year. Therefore, it's recommended you do the park and and bus routine that the CO used last year. Keep in mind that the parade might block your traffic depending on where you parked, and that the traffic may be congested due to everyone trying to leave at once.
